About C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S

  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S is a powerful combination medication designed to combat a wide range of bacterial infections. It contains two active ingredients: Cefpodoxime Proxetil and Clavulanate Potassium. Cefpodoxime Proxetil is a cephalosporin antibiotic that works by inhibiting the synthesis of bacterial cell walls, leading to bacterial cell death. Clavulanate Potassium, on the other hand, is a beta-lactamase inhibitor. It prevents bacteria from inactivating Cefpodoxime, thereby enhancing its effectiveness.
  • This medication is typically prescribed for infections of the respiratory tract (such as pneumonia, bronchitis, and sinusitis), skin and soft tissue infections, urinary tract infections, and other bacterial infections. The combination of Cefpodoxime and Clavulanate ensures a broader spectrum of antibacterial activity, making it effective against many resistant bacteria strains.
  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S should be taken as directed by your healthcare provider. The dosage and duration of treatment depend on the severity and type of infection. It's crucial to complete the full course of medication, even if you start feeling better, to ensure complete eradication of the bacteria and prevent the development of antibiotic resistance.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al pain. If you experience any severe or persistent side effects, consult your doctor immediately.
  • Before taking C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S, inform your doctor about any allergies you have, especially to cephalosporin antibiotics or penicillin. Also, disclose any other medications you are taking, as drug interactions may occur. This medication may not be suitable for individuals with certain medical conditions, such as kidney or liver problems. Always follow your doctor's instructions and read the medication guide carefully for complete information.

How C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S Works

  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S is a combination medication designed to combat bacterial infections effectively. It harnesses the synergistic power of two active ingredients: Cefpodoxime and Clavulanic Acid. Understanding how each component functions is crucial to appreciating the overall efficacy of this medication.
  • **Cefpodoxime: A Cephalosporin Antibiotic** Cefpodoxime belongs to the cephalosporin class of antibiotics. Its primary mechanism of action involves interfering with the synthesis of the bacterial cell wall. Bacteria, unlike human cells, possess a rigid cell wall that provides structural integrity and protection. Cefpodoxime inhibits the enzymes responsible for cross-linking the peptidoglycans, which are essential building blocks of the bacterial cell wall. By disrupting this cross-linking process, Cefpodoxime weakens the cell wall, making it fragile and prone to rupture. As a result, the bacterial cell loses its integrity and eventually dies. Cefpodoxime is effective against a broad spectrum of bacteria, including many gram-positive and gram-negative organisms. Its ability to target the bacterial cell wall makes it a potent weapon against bacterial infections.
  • **Clavulanic Acid: A Beta-Lactamase Inhibitor** Many bacteria have developed resistance mechanisms against antibiotics like Cefpodoxime. One common mechanism is the production of beta-lactamase enzymes. These enzymes can break down the beta-lactam ring, a crucial structural component of cephalosporin antibiotics like Cefpodoxime, rendering the antibiotic ineffective. Clavulanic Acid steps in as a beta-lactamase inhibitor. It binds to and inactivates beta-lactamase enzymes, preventing them from degrading Cefpodoxime. By protecting Cefpodoxime from enzymatic breakdown, Clavulanic Acid ensures that the antibiotic remains active and can effectively target the bacterial cell wall. This synergistic effect of Cefpodoxime and Clavulanic Acid broadens the spectrum of bacteria that the medication can combat and helps overcome antibiotic resistance.
  • **The Synergistic Action: A Powerful Combination** In essence, C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S works by a two-pronged approach. Cefpodoxime directly attacks the bacterial cell wall, while Clavulanic Acid protects Cefpodoxime from being destroyed by bacterial enzymes. This combination allows the medication to effectively kill bacteria and resolve the infection. The medicine is absorbed into the bloodstream, and the active ingredients are distributed to the site of infection. The combined action leads to the inhibition of bacterial growth and ultimately the eradication of the infection. C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S is typically prescribed for various bacterial infections, including respiratory tract infections, skin infections, and urinary tract infections. Its effectiveness stems from its ability to target the bacterial cell wall while simultaneously overcoming bacterial resistance mechanisms.

Side Effects of C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'SArrow

Common side effects of CEFOZYT CV Tablet may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, abdominal pain, indigestion, and loss of appetite. Some patients may experience headache, dizziness, or fatigue. Less common side effects can involve allergic reactions like skin rash, itching, or hives. In rare cases, more serious side effects such as liver problems, kidney problems, or blood disorders might occur. Consult your doctor immediately if you notice any severe or persistent side effects.

Dosage of C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'SArrow

  • The dosage of C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S should be strictly as prescribed by your physician. The information provided here is for general understanding and should not be used as a substitute for professional medical advice. Typically, the dosage is determined based on the severity of the infection, the patient's age, weight, kidney function, and overall health condition.
  • A common dosage regimen for adults with mild to moderate infections is one tablet taken orally every 12 hours. For more severe infections, the physician may increase the dosage or frequency. It is crucial to complete the entire course of treatment, even if symptoms improve before the medication is finished. Prematurely stopping the medication can lead to the recurrence of the infection and the development of antibiotic resistance.
  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S should be swallowed whole with a glass of water. It can be taken with or without food, but taking it with food may help reduce potential gastrointestinal side effects. If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ember, unless it is almost time for your next scheduled dose. In that case,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ular dosing schedule. Do not double the dose to make up for a missed one.
  • Patients with kidney problems may require dosage adjustments. It is essential to inform your doctor about any pre-existing kidney conditions so they can determine the appropriate dosage for you. Similarly, elderly patients may need lower doses due to age-related changes in kidney function. The doctor will conduct necessary examinations before prescribing the medicine. Always follow your doctor's instructions and consult them if you have any questions or concerns regarding the dosage or administration of C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S.

How to use C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'SArrow

  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S is an oral medication, meaning it is taken by mouth. Always follow your doctor's prescription precisely regarding dosage and duration of treatment. Do not alter the dosage yourself, even if you feel better or worse, without consulting your healthcare provider.
  • The tablet should be swallowed whole with a full glass of water. Do not crush, chew, or break the tablet, as this can affect how the medication is absorbed in your body. It is generally recommended to take C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S at the same time each day to maintain a consistent level of medication in your system. This consistency helps ensure the medication works effectively.
  • C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S can be taken with or without food. However, if you experience stomach upset, taking it with food may help. Avoid taking it with antacids containing aluminum or magnesium, as these can interfere with the absorption of the medication. If you need to take an antacid, take it several hours before or after taking C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S.
  • Complete the full course of treatment even if your symptoms improve within a few days. Stopping the medication prematurely can lead to the infection recurring or becoming resistant to antibiotics. If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ular dosing schedule. Do not take a double dose to make up for a missed one.
  • During treatment with CEFOZYT CV TABLET 10'S, it is important to stay hydrated by drinking plenty of fluids. This helps to flush out the infection and prevent dehydration. Be aware of potential side effects, such as n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, or allergic reactions. If you experience any severe or persistent side effects, contact your doctor immediately. Store the medication in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and out of reach of children.
